- Improved my thermals - Brendan, 17 February 2024
Sitting with a Corsair H115i, the 12700K was idling at 31-33 on average, CB23 pushed all cores over 88 degrees Celsius (I think it touched 90 when the room was 30 dc), so swapping out the stock bracket for this, I saw my idling temps at 25-26 and my CB23 all core test at 81 max. I'm pretty happy with that, for R99, this fixed what intel and board vendors broke. Considering the 81 max, you'll never see that in a game or day-to-day office workload. It was a quick and easy swap, just keep the CPU in and make sure your cooler bracket is still covering the back of the CPU block, then it won't slide out.
